The Germany intrauterine devices (IUD) market is experiencing steady growth driven by factors such as increasing awareness about long-acting reversible contraception methods, rising adoption of IUDs among women due to their high efficacy rates, and the government`s initiatives to promote family planning. Key players in the market are focusing on product innovation, such as the development of hormone-releasing IUDs, to cater to the evolving needs of consumers. The market is characterized by intense competition, with companies investing in marketing strategies to expand their market presence. Additionally, favorable reimbursement policies for contraceptive devices and the presence of a well-established healthcare infrastructure are further contributing to the growth of the IUD market in Germany.

In the Germany intrauterine devices market, some challenges faced include regulatory hurdles and a conservative healthcare system. Regulatory requirements for medical devices in Germany are stringent, leading to lengthy approval processes that can hinder market entry for new products. Additionally, the conservative nature of the healthcare system in Germany may result in resistance to adopting new technologies or contraceptive methods like intrauterine devices. Furthermore, there may be limited awareness among both healthcare providers and patients about the benefits and effectiveness of IUDs, which could impact their uptake and market penetration. Overcoming these challenges would require targeted educational campaigns, building strong relationships with key stakeholders, and navigating the complex regulatory landscape to drive growth in the Germany IUD market.

In Germany, government policies related to the intrauterine devices market primarily focus on ensuring safety, efficacy, and accessibility of these contraceptive devices. The Federal Institute for Drugs and Medical Devices (BfArM) regulates the approval and monitoring of intrauterine devices to guarantee their quality and compliance with health standards. Additionally, the German healthcare system provides coverage for intrauterine devices under statutory health insurance, making them more affordable and accessible to women. The government also promotes education and awareness campaigns to inform the public about the benefits and risks associated with intrauterine devices, aiming to increase their usage and contribute to effective family planning strategies in the country.
